Question

There are 4 boxes with 6 chocolates in each. Complete the given equation to calculate the total number of chocolates.
___ + ___ + ___ + ___ = ___ groups of 6 = ___

Solution

The correct option is B 6, 6, 6, 6, 4, 24
  • There are 4 boxes.
  • There are 6 chocolates in each box.
  • Therefore, there are 4 groups of 6 chocolates.
  • Since there are an equal number of chocolates in each box, we can use repeated addition.
  • There are 4 boxes with 6 chocolates in each, so we will add 6, 4 times.
  • Therefore, total number of chocolates = 6 + 6 + 6 + 6 = 4 groups of 6 = 24 chocolates.
  • Hence, option B is correct.
